seen some overflow chambers that are doubled layered, slits on bottom outside piece then water flows over the top of the inner layer.

Would seem rather silly that the slits on yours would be all the way through. Not a smart way to build overflow.
Thanks Mark yes it was double walled. I was able to take out both drains and both pipes from the return lines. I tried to vacum out as much of the sludge on the bottom but it was too thick for my "tank only shop vac". I poured a half a bucket of fresh water in the overflow and this is the water that came out that came out. This is after sitting in the bucket for 1hr.


After pouring water out this is the 2" of sludge that was left that was filled with some pretty big bristtle worms.


This tank has been setup for about 3 years. How often do you people clean out your overflows? I've never thought of it.
